They are therefore unaffected by eating hot pepper bird seeds … WebNov 6, 2024 · Generally speaking, your chickens can eat hot peppers. Due to chickens having an inactive TRPV1 receptor, they cannot taste the capsaicin which is the compound that causes the burning sensation we feel when we eat hot spicy foods. Instead, they can pass the pepper through their digestive system without issues.
